WOODLANDS GREEN LTD
Financial health, per its FY2025 accounts
The accounts state that the charity reported a net surplus of £125,811 for the year ended 5 April 2025, bringing total unrestricted funds to £4,324,740. The trustees consider the financial position to be satisfactory and have confirmed there are no material uncertainties regarding the charity's ability to continue as a going concern. The charity maintains sufficient reserves to meet demands from charitable organizations, although no specific policy target amount is defined.
What the accounts disclose
“The charity attempts to maintain sufficient reserves to meet the ever increasing demands on its funds from various charitable organisations.” — page 4
“Other debtors includes amounts aggregating £1,497,865 due from charities where the trustees of this charity are trustees. The loans are interest free and repayable on demand.” — page 18
“Other debtors includes an amount of £171,568 due from a company where the trustees of this charity are directors. During the period, interest was charged on this loan at the rate of 5% per annum.” — page 18

Income and spending
| Financial year end | Income | Spending |
|---|---|---|
| 05/04/2025 | £371k | £245k |
| 05/04/2024 | £330k | £290k |
| 05/04/2023 | £362k | £307k |
| 05/04/2022 | £332k | £227k |
| 05/04/2021 | £279k | £241k |
